Announcement summary
Everpure (NYSE: P) announced it will host a conference call on Wednesday, May 27, at 2:00 p.m. PT to discuss its financial results for the first quarter of fiscal 2027, which ended May 3, 2026. The call will be available via live audio broadcast and replay on the Everpure Investor Relations website. Everpure is also scheduled to participate in three investor conferences on June 3, 2026, including the William Blair 46th Annual Growth Conference, Evercore Global TMT Conference, and Bank of America Global Technology Conference. The company highlights its industry-leading storage and data management platform and recognition as a leader in the 2025 Gartner Magic Quadrant for Enterprise Storage Platforms and Infrastructure Platform Consumption Services.
